The airline Delta Air Lines accumulated growth of 56% of its capacity in the market over the past five years, besides increasing the number of passengers by 62% over the same period, according to data released Tuesday by the company.
Delta celebrates, this tecra Thursday, 15 years of service in Brazil. The company offers 35 weekly direct flights to Sao Paulo, Brasilia and Rio de Janeiro. "Our sustained growth over the past five years shows that our actions are on target. We have made great progress and growth in Brazil reflects the support of our customers and shows the initial fruits of our new alliance with Delta," said the president of Delta Air Lines Ed Bastian.
The alliance with Brazilian airline was announced in December last year, with an investment of U.S. $ 100 million.
According to the airline until August passengers can use points for sets of tickets sales companies in Brasilia and Sao Paulo. "When comparing the first five months of 2012 with the same period last year, found a 28% increase in passenger numbers in connection with the Gol flights from Delta," said Delta's vice president for Latin America and the Caribbean Nicolas Ferri.
